Josep Mª Suriol, Export Manager for PepWines uses the philosophy that his products should be of a very high level, working with both small and medium producers in Catalunya. Mr. Suriol considers three key factors when selecting wineries – quality of the product, design of the label and how the owner is with his winemakers. [...]

Priorat Wine & Culinary Tourism gets French Touch
The unique landscape of the Priorat region is best known for its wine and olive oil. However, it contains another hidden gem in the town of Siurana, a city dating back to prehistory as a flint workshop and later as a Muslim stronghold, specifically La Siuranella Hotel and Restaurant.
